A block of mass m, lying on a horizontal plane, is acted upon by a horizontal force P and another force Q, inclined at an angle θ to the vertical. The block  ill remain in equilibrium, if the coefficient of friction between it and the surface is:

a
(P+Q sin θ)(mg+Q cos θ)
b
(P cos θ +Q)(mg-Q sin θ)
c
(P + Q cos θ)(mg +Q sin θ)
d
(P sin θ-Q)-(mg-Q cos θ)

detailed solution

Correct option is

Frictional force = μR = μ(mg+Q cosθ)And horizontal push = P+Q sin θFor equilibrium, we haveμ(mg+Q cos θ) = P+Q sin θμ = P+Q sin θmg+Q cos θ
